Californian bungalow style, prime location
If you're looking for a project in one of Deniliquin's most sought-after streets, look no further. A Californian bungalow style home on a quarter-acre corner block only a short walk to the CBD is a rare gem. Despite needing a renovation overhaul, the timber home still echoes the characteristics of an early 20th Century period home - 12-foot ceilings, timber fretwork, sash windows, timber veranda, and a triple gable facing Wick St are all part of the yesteryear appeal. For a couple with DIY credentials, you could easily live in the home and refurbish one section at a time. There are two large bedrooms, the main with a split system, open fireplace, built-in robes and ensuite with freestanding cast iron bath, shower, toilet and two vanities. The large loungeroom has a split system, open fireplace with timber mantlepiece, and a feature box bay window, while the dining room has a Coonara wood heater and leadlight skylight. Other features include a second bathroom / laundry with shower and toilet, kitchen with walk-in pantry, stove and gas cooktop, a third bedroom with BIR, and a sleepout or study off the kitchen. Outside is left to your imagination. You could enhance the lawn and garden network that's already in place, extend the home, or build a big shed with access from Hunter St at the rear of the block. There is also PRIME subdivision potential STCA. All this just a short walk to the RSL, Golf and Bowling clubs, the CBD, state forests and Edward River, and located in one of Deni's quietest and most popular streets.
